Rock County board considers committee term limits

Rock County Board members appear very loyal to their committee assignments. The board Thursday night voted overwhelming against a proposal by supervisor Yuri Rashkin to implement term limits for board members on standing committees.   Rashkin suggested supervisors serve no more than two consecutive two-year terms before taking at least one year off. Other supervisors argued it takes time to get a full understanding of what a committees considers, and experience offers expertise in dealing with the issues. Board Chairman Russ Podzilni added how close to a third of supervisory seats change hands every two years anyway, so turnover occurs regardless of limits. Rashkin reminded the board, supervisors are elected officials and not hired as experts. The vote was 19-to-four against.
